This was like having your own private beach, because there is no other construction for miles around this place and the town is about 20 to 30 minutes driving.
As we touch the water on the beach it was as warm as the swimming pool, and there is a large area where the water level only reach up to your waist, that was good for my friend who have two children ages 5 and 7
This beach is not for surfing or bodyboard because there are no waves but other beach activities can be done here.

vacation on the beach
We were talking with my 17 year old son (who want to study and enter the field of engineering and architect in the university) about how they have turn this deserted area into this green vacation place by taking the water from the ocean and send it through a process of desalination and water purification they turn ocean water into purified water which is life for the green grass, plants and ready for human consumption and other necessities.
This place is just a small percentage of the original plan which includes several beautiful green grass and palms, ocean side golf courses, shopping centers, dance club, theaters, a marina with boat docking facilities, an soon an airport. As an enjoyable tradition, the city of Santa Monica will present a series of live music, dance and entertainment.
Every Summer the city organize several shows at the Santa Monica Pier for the enjoyment of their resident and tourist who visit our great sunny beaches of Southern California.ballroomdance_courtesy_of_Wikicommons
The shows are free to enter and they are scheduled for every Thursday at 7pm beginning June 26th 2008.
Check for schedule of your favorite type of performer, band or music, witch run from Latin dance like Salsa, Cumbia, Bachata, Merengue, Tango and other Latin dance styles,  Hawaiian music, Rock music, Jazz and other American and International dance.
